How to Turn Off TalkBack on Android?

If you’re having trouble turning off TalkBack on your Android phone, no worries! It’s actually pretty easy to do. Just keep in mind that the steps might vary depending on your phone model, Android version, or TalkBack app version.

Here are a few ways you can turn off TalkBack: you can press the volume buttons, ask Google Assistant for help, or tweak your Accessibility settings. So don’t sweat it – just give one of these methods a try and you should be good to go. Now let’s begin with the procedures.

Step 1: Use the Volume Buttons

To disable TalkBack on your Android device, the quickest method is to use the volume buttons. During device setup, you will be presented with the option to enable TalkBack, and if you did, you can quickly disable it by pressing the volume buttons. Additionally, you can use a shortcut on the volume key to toggle TalkBack on and off.

  • Your device side has two volume keys visible.
  • Hold down both volume buttons for a duration of 2-3 seconds.

  • The TalkBack feature will announce “TalkBack OFF“, indicating that the accessibility function on the device has been disabled.

If this method of turning off TalkBack doesn’t work, try the next one below.

Step 2: Turn off via Accessibility

  • Open the Settings app on your Android device.
  • Scroll down and tap on the “Accessibility” option.
  • In the Accessibility menu, select “Vision” and then click on “Talkback“.

  • Toggle the switches off for “TalkBack“.

Turn Off TalkBack on Android

  • Finally, click on “STOP” to turn off TalkBack on your Android device.

Step 3: Use Google Assistant

Here’s an alternative way to disable TalkBack on your Android device: using Google Assistant. It’s worth noting that on an Android phone, Google Assistant can perform a wide range of tasks, including turning off TalkBack. Here’s how you can use it to do so:

  • Activate Google Assistant.
  • Say the phrase “Turn off TalkBack“.

How to Disable Lock Screen TalkBack?

If you don’t want to use the accessibility feature on your phone’s lock screen, you can turn off TalkBack specifically for that function. Doing so can help safeguard your privacy and prevent your phone from speaking to you while it’s locked. To disable TalkBack from working on the lock screen, follow the steps outlined below.

Android 11 and above:

  • Open the “Settings” app on your device.
  • Scroll down and tap on “Accessibility“.
  • Navigate to the bottom of the Accessibility settings page.
  • Turn off the toggle switch “Shortcut from lock screen“.

Android 10 and below:

  • Open the Settings app.
  • Click on Accessibility.
  • Select the Volume key.
  • Turn off “Permit from lock screen”.

The task is complete, and if necessary, you can undo the steps to re-enable the feature.
